When you establish the rent for your flat that is furnished, be careful not to price yourself out of the marketplace. You may be unable to rent the apartment to anyone, if you set the rent too high. You might be better off to sell or keep them and let the apartment unfurnished, if you're concerned about your furnishings. Generally, the rent should be set by you based on your own expenses to own and maintain the property, including the furnishings, plus your desired rate of return on your own investment. For instance, to make $5,000 per year on the property, the yearly rent you want if it costs you $15,000 per year to possess and maintain the property, and should be $20,000, or about $1,675 per month. Compare that price to charge rent which will meet your needs, taking into account furnishings and the features of your property, and other rents in the place still be competitive.

When letting a furnished apartment to protect your investment, it is wise to provide the tenant with an itemized list of the items contained in the apartment lease. Be really specific; record the amount of plates, bowls, and cups, for instance, and describe things as accurately as possible. List the replacement cost of each thing if the renter takes the piece with him when he moves out, or if it's damaged beyond ordinary wear and tear. Indicate if the renter will need to pay you directly for the items, or if the replacement cost will be taken out of the security deposit. Have so there aren't any surprises when the rental comes to a finish the tenant sign a copy of this inventory.

If you rent a house or flat that is furnished, whether it contains only some basic furniture or is entirely furnished with furniture, linens, electronics, and accessories, you can charge renters rent that is higher. You will have to replace those things if they're damaged or destroyed, and had to buy the things which are furnishing the house. Those costs will be recouped by a monthly rent that is higher. It is up to you as the landlord to determine how much more you need to charge for the furnishings, but typically owners will base the increased price on the state and style of the furnishings. For instance, a property which includes a brand-new, modern living room set is worth more than one that comprises bits that are mismatched with frayed seams.

In addition to or instead of a higher rent for a furnished apartment, you could ask for a higher security deposit on the lease. Collecting more cash up front can help you cover the costs of replacing or repairing the items in the furnished apartment if they are damaged. Check with your state laws before collecting the security deposit, however. Some states have laws regulating what landlords can charge and security deposits. You could also charge a separate cleaning fee for the rental, to cover the costs of cleaning furniture, bedding, curtains and other items, if you do not want to contain it in the security deposit.

Any service that incurs a fee should be included in the lease, including cellphone usage, garbage, laundry, housekeeping, and parking. Occasionally, optional services are available, like housekeeping services in addition to cleaning upon departure. These should be, at a minimum, recorded on the lease in case the vacationers choose to use the service after they arrive. Expectancies about the use of the property should also be clearly indicated--either in the lease or via a procedures manual referenced in the contract. Who cleans the grill? Who takes the garbage out and where does it go? Should the vacationers or by housekeeping strip the sheets? Must the dishes be washed before housekeeping arrives? All of these are issues which should be addressed avoid conflicts over the lease and the stay and to ensure a smooth vacation.

The dates and times of departure and arrival are spelled out in great specificity in the vacation rental lease. Vacationers are coming and going every week--sometimes every few days--and the units must be cleaned between stays. To avoid vacancy between stays, the time between check in and checkout is usually a relatively brief window. And because some vacationers rely on air transportation, there are occasionally last minute requests to arrive or depart late or early. It's, thus, vital that you include eventuality requests in the lease, signaling both a cost and a procedure to shift agreed upon strategies.
